90 LS 400, had the antilock / traction off light on. The code was a bad speed sensor in the RR. so had that replaced today.
But I can't get the codes to clear, I've already checked the connection of the new sensor, done the TC & E1 jump and pressing pedal 8 times within 3 second multiple times.
There was a code 35 before, but now the Antilock doesnt flash to give a code anymore. but both lights wont go away.
I checked and topped off the brake fluid as well just to be on the safe side incase that was creating it.
Might try resetting the ECU, unplug the battery for about half an hour to an hour (to kill the backup reserve battery) then hook it back up try to see if that does the trick.

Make sure you have the Ignition set to Key On Engine Off while you preform the jumper and brake process. When you are done you need remove the jumper and then cycle the ignition off and then on again. The lamp should then be off.
